    After Stephen Curry came up limping from another blow to his sore left leg, Golden State coach Luke Walton thought the reigning MVP should take the rest of the night off while the Warriors wrapped up another blowout win.

    Walton also knows Steph wouldn't be Steph if it was that easy to keep him off the court.

    Klay Thompson scored 22 of his 36 points in the first quarter and Curry added 17 before sitting out the fourth to rest his ailing leg in Golden State's 109-88 victory over the Los Angeles Lakers on Tuesday night.
